Keeping Your Trailer Tire Bearings Happy

Wheel bearings endure tremendous radial and thrust loads while spinning at highway speeds. The Dexter 21-36 hub cap, designed for 9K-15K axles, creates a sealed environment protecting these precision components from road salt, water, and debris.

What bearings need to thrive:

  • Consistent lubrication film: Prevents metal-to-metal contact under 2,000+ lbs load per wheel
  • Temperature control: Operating range 0°F-250°F; overheating destroys grease structure
  • Contaminant exclusion: Water intrusion causes corrosion, leading to spalling and failure

Healthy bearings spin smoothly without growl or drag. The Dexter 21-36’s 4-inch threaded design with O-ring seal maintains negative pressure, preventing moisture ingress during pressure washing or puddle crossings. Check hub temperature after 30 miles—if noticeably warmer than axle housing, investigate immediately.

Visual inspection reveals early problems:

  • Leaking grease around spindle indicates seal failure
  • Hub cap separation suggests thread damage
  • Discoloration signals overheating (blue/black indicates 400°F+)

How to Lubricate Your Bearings

Proper greasing technique separates professionals from amateurs. Overpacking destroys seals; underpacking starves bearings. Follow this proven method for Dexter oil bath or grease-packed hubs.

Step-by-step lubrication process:

  1. Elevate trailer using axle stands (never jacks alone)
  2. Remove Dexter 21-36 hub cap using 2½” socket or cap wrench
  3. Drain old lubricant through bottom plug; inspect for metal flakes
  4. Clean spindle with solvent; check races for scoring
  5. Inspect bearings—replace if rollers show flat spots or pitting
  6. Repack inner bearing with NLGI #2 high-temp marine grease (½ cup)
  7. Reinstall seal, outer bearing, hub, washers, and lug nuts (torque 75-85 ft-lbs)
  8. Replace Dexter 21-36 hub cap with new O-ring; torque to 20-30 ft-lbs

Pro tip: Always replace bearings as pairs (inner/outer) and match races. Single bearing failure contaminates the entire assembly.

How Often Should You Grease Travel Trailer Wheel Bearings

Maintenance intervals depend on usage, environment, and axle rating. Commercial operators need shorter cycles than recreational users.

Recommended schedule by operation type:

  • Heavy commercial (daily hauling): Every 12 months or 25,000 miles
  • Regional delivery: Every 18 months or 40,000 miles
  • Light commercial: Every 24 months or 50,000 miles
  • Recreational: Every 12 months regardless of mileage

Environmental accelerators:

  • Salt road exposure: Reduce intervals 50%
  • Frequent pressure washing: Check quarterly
  • Dusty construction sites: Monthly visual inspections
  • Mountain grades (continuous braking): Every 8,000 miles

The Dexter 21-36 hub cap’s oil sight glass provides instant visual confirmation. Amber oil = healthy; milky = water contamination; metallic sheen = bearing distress. Implement a hub temperature log—anything over 160°F post-trip warrants immediate teardown.
